Захватывающие проекты в Excel с VBA

Если вы регулярно используете Microsoft Excel в своей работе, то наверняка знаете, что программа предлагает множество функций и возможностей для управления данными. Однако, для того чтобы сделать работу более эффективной и продуктивной, иногда приходится прибегать к написанию собственных макросов и скриптов.

В этой статье мы рассмотрим Excel проекты с VBA (Visual Basic for Applications) — интегрированной среды разработки, которая позволяет автоматизировать задачи и создавать пользовательские функции в Excel. Применение VBA позволяет не только существенно сократить время, затрачиваемое на рутинные операции, но и организовать данные таким образом, чтобы они стали более понятными и удобными для анализа и использования.

Excel проекты с VBA варьируются от простых макросов, автоматически запускающихся по нажатию кнопки или определенным событиям, до сложных приложений, включающих пользовательские формы и базы данных. С помощью VBA можно создавать интерактивные дашборды, расчетные модели, отчеты и многое другое.

Программирование на VBA может показаться сложным для новичков, однако с подходящими руководствами и примерами, вы сможете быстро овладеть этим инструментом и извлечь максимальную пользу для своей работы. В следующих статьях мы будем рассматривать различные аспекты работы с VBA в Excel и предлагать полезные советы и рекомендации для успешного выполнения проектов.

Для тех, кто хочет улучшить свои навыки Excel и повысить свою производительность, использование VBA-проектов является очевидным шагом. Надеемся, что наши статьи помогут вам лучше разобраться с этим инструментом и использовать его в своей повседневной работе.

Проекты Excel с использованием VBA: полное руководство для начинающих

Перед началом работы с VBA, необходимо убедиться, что в вашей версии Excel данный язык программирования включен. Обычно VBA является стандартной функцией в Excel, но в некоторых случаях может потребоваться дополнительная установка. После установки и активации VBA, вы можете начать создавать свои проекты.

Одной из самых важных функций VBA является возможность создавать макросы. Макросы представляют собой последовательность команд, которые могут быть запущены одним нажатием кнопки или определенным действием. Это очень полезно, когда вам нужно повторять определенные операции в Excel. Например, вы можете создать макрос для автоматического форматирования данных или создания сводных таблиц. Для создания макроса в Excel вы должны открыть вкладку «Разработчик» и выбрать «Запись макроса». Затем следуйте инструкциям и выполните действия, которые вы хотите записать. После того, как вы закончите запись макроса, он будет сохранен и готов к использованию.

Читайте также:  Gnu bash windows 10

Кроме макросов, VBA также позволяет создавать пользовательские функции в Excel. Пользовательские функции — это специальные функции, которые вы можете создать с помощью VBA и использовать в своих таблицах и формулах Excel. Например, вы можете создать пользовательскую функцию для вычисления сложных математических операций или для выполнения специализированных расчетов. Чтобы создать пользовательскую функцию, вы должны открыть редактор VBA в Excel, выбрать вкладку «Вставка» и создать новый модуль. В модуле вы можете написать свой код для функции и сохранить его. После сохранения функции, она будет доступна в Excel, и вы сможете использовать ее в своих ячейках и формулах.

Разработка макросов VBA для автоматизации в Excel

Разработка макросов VBA требует некоторых навыков программирования, но она также доступна для новичков. Важно понять основы VBA, такие как переменные, условные операторы и циклы, чтобы создавать макросы, которые выполняют необходимые операции. Макросы VBA также могут быть записаны и редактированы непосредственно в редакторе VBA в Excel, что облегчает процесс разработки.

С помощью разработки макросов VBA в Excel вы можете автоматизировать различные задачи, такие как импорт и экспорт данных, форматирование и фильтрация данных, создание отчетов и графиков, взаимодействие с другими приложениями и многое другое. Вместо того, чтобы тратить время на ручную обработку данных, вы можете создать макросы, которые выполняют эти задачи за вас, что позволяет сэкономить время и снизить вероятность ошибок.

Разработка макросов VBA также позволяет добавлять интерактивность в Excel. Вы можете создавать пользовательские формы, которые позволяют пользователям вводить данные и взаимодействовать с ними. Это особенно полезно для создания пользовательских приложений в Excel, где можно создавать интерфейсы для управления данными и выполнения задач.

В целом, разработка макросов VBA для автоматизации в Excel предлагает множество возможностей для улучшения процессов работы и повышения эффективности. Она позволяет сделать работу более удобной и продуктивной, освободив вас от рутинных и монотонных задач, чтобы вы могли сконцентрироваться на более важных задачах и принять более обоснованные решения.

Основы программирования VBA в Excel

Что такое VBA?

VBA (Visual Basic for Applications) — это мощный язык программирования, встроенный в приложения Microsoft Office, включая Excel. VBA позволяет пользователям создавать и исполнять макросы, автоматизировать повторяющиеся задачи, а также создавать пользовательские функции для обработки данных. Одним из главных преимуществ VBA является его интеграция с Excel, что позволяет взаимодействовать с данными, ячейками и формулами напрямую.

Как начать программировать в VBA?

Для начала программирования в VBA в Excel необходимо открыть встроенный редактор VBA. Это можно сделать, щелкнув правой кнопкой мыши на ленте инструментов Excel и выбрав «Настройка ленты». Затем нужно активировать вкладку «Разработчик» и щелкнуть на кнопке «Макросы». В открывшемся окне можно создать новый макрос и начинать программировать.

  • Изучение основных конструкций языка: Чтобы программировать в VBA, необходимо ознакомиться с основными конструкциями языка, такими как переменные, условные операторы, циклы и процедуры. Это позволяет создавать программы и макросы с целевой направленностью и логикой.
  • Практика и экспериментирование: Лучший способ освоить программирование в VBA — это практика. Создавайте небольшие программы и макросы, экспериментируйте с различными функциями и методами. Только через практическое применение и исследование возможностей VBA вы сможете улучшить свои навыки и стать более опытным разработчиком.
  • Поиск информации и обучение: В Интернете можно найти большое количество ресурсов, посвященных программированию VBA в Excel. Они представляют различные учебники, видеоуроки и форумы, где вы можете задавать вопросы и учиться у опытных разработчиков. Определенно стоит пользоваться этими ресурсами, чтобы поднять свой уровень и узнать новые подходы к программированию в VBA.
Читайте также:  Gta samp для windows 10

Заключение

Программирование VBA в Excel является мощным инструментом для автоматизации задач и обработки данных. Знание основных конструкций языка и практическое применение помогут вам стать более уверенным программистом в VBA. Не стесняйтесь использовать различные ресурсы и экспериментировать с разными методами и функциями. Вскоре вы увидите, как VBA упрощает вашу работу и открывает новые возможности в Excel.

Создание интерактивных пользовательских форм в Excel с помощью VBA

Создание интерактивных пользовательских форм в Excel может быть очень полезным для улучшения удобства использования и обработки данных. Например, вы можете создать форму для ввода данных, где пользователь может заполнять различные поля и затем сохранять введенную информацию в таблицу Excel. Также можно добавить кнопки и элементы управления, которые выполняют определенные действия при нажатии.

Для создания интерактивных пользовательских форм в Excel с помощью VBA вы можете использовать редактор кода VBA, встроенный в Excel. В редакторе кода вы можете написать свой код, определяющий, какие элементы формы будут отображаться и как они будут взаимодействовать с данными. Вы также можете настроить свойства элементов формы, такие как размер, местоположение и стиль.

Например, вы можете создать форму с текстовым полем для ввода имени, полем для выбора даты и кнопкой «Сохранить». Когда пользователь заполняет поле имени и выбирает дату, он может нажать кнопку «Сохранить», и данные будут сохранены в таблицу Excel. Вы также можете добавить проверку данных, чтобы убедиться, что пользователь вводит корректные значения.

Использование VBA для создания интерактивных пользовательских форм в Excel способствует автоматизации повторяющихся задач и улучшению производительности. Это также позволяет создавать пользовательские интерфейсы, более удобные для работы с данными. Благодаря возможностям VBA в Excel вы можете адаптировать приложение под свои потребности и сделать его более эффективным.

Читайте также:  Обход проверку подлинности windows

Работа с данными в Excel с использованием VBA

VBA — это язык программирования, встроенный в Excel, который позволяет создавать макросы и автоматизированные процессы для работы с данными. С его помощью можно выполнять такие задачи, как автоматическое заполнение данных, вычисления, создание отчетов и визуализаций, а также взаимодействие с другими приложениями Microsoft Office.

Одним из наиболее полезных преимуществ использования VBA в Excel является возможность создания пользовательских функций. Пользовательские функции позволяют расширить функциональность Excel, добавив собственные формулы и операции. Например, вы можете создать функцию, которая автоматически суммирует значения в столбце или выполняет сложные вычисления на основе заданных параметров.

Программирование с использованием VBA не только упрощает работу с данными, но и значительно повышает эффективность процессов обработки информации. Вместо того, чтобы выполнять однотипные действия вручную, VBA может выполнить эти задачи за вас, освободив время для других важных задач.

Однако, для того чтобы в полной мере воспользоваться преимуществами VBA, вам потребуется изучить основы программирования и языка VBA. Но не волнуйтесь, сделать это не так сложно, и результаты будут стоить потраченной энергии и времени. Вам потребуется изучить основные понятия, такие как переменные, циклы, условные операторы, а также ознакомиться со специфическими объектами и методами, используемыми в Excel.

Улучшение производительности проектов Excel с помощью VBA

В данной статье мы рассмотрели преимущества и применение языка программирования VBA для оптимизации работы с проектами в Excel. VBA (Visual Basic for Applications) позволяет автоматизировать множество операций, упрощая их выполнение и значительно повышая эффективность работы.

С помощью VBA вы можете создавать макросы, которые выполняют определенные задачи автоматически и мгновенно. Это особенно полезно при работе с большим объемом данных или повторяющимися операциями. Например, вы можете создать макрос для автоматического форматирования данных, создания отчетов или графиков, фильтрации и сортировки информации и многого другого.

Программирование на VBA также позволяет использовать условные операторы, циклы и функции, которые значительно расширяют возможности Excel. Вы можете создавать сложные алгоритмы, обрабатывать данные по определенным условиям и создавать пользовательские функции для удобного расчета значений.

Улучшение производительности проектов Excel с помощью VBA не только экономит время, но и позволяет сократить возможные ошибки и повысить точность данных. Благодаря автоматизации рутинных задач, вы сможете сосредоточиться на более сложных и творческих заданиях, что приведет к повышению эффективности и качества работы.

Оцените статью